C# Класс EvilDICOM.Anonymization.Anonymizers.StudyIdAnonymizer

Removes the study id from the DICOM files and creates a new study id
Наследование: IAnonymizer
Показать файл Открыть проект

Private Properties

Свойство Тип Описание
GetTypeAbbreviation string

Открытые методы

Метод Описание
AddDICOMObject ( DICOMObject d ) : void
Anonymize ( DICOMObject d ) : void
FinalizeDictionary ( ) : void

This method is to be called once all DICOM objects are added. It then remaps study ids in a private dictionary

GenerateNames ( ) : void
GenerateNamesByType ( ) : void
GetFileType ( DICOMObject d ) : DICOMFileType
StudyIdAnonymizer ( ) : EvilDICOM.Core

Приватные методы

Метод Описание
GetTypeAbbreviation ( DICOMFileType type ) : string

Описание методов

AddDICOMObject() публичный Метод

public AddDICOMObject ( DICOMObject d ) : void
d DICOMObject
Результат void

Anonymize() публичный Метод

public Anonymize ( DICOMObject d ) : void
d DICOMObject
Результат void

FinalizeDictionary() публичный Метод

This method is to be called once all DICOM objects are added. It then remaps study ids in a private dictionary
public FinalizeDictionary ( ) : void
Результат void

GenerateNames() публичный Метод

public GenerateNames ( ) : void
Результат void

GenerateNamesByType() публичный Метод

public GenerateNamesByType ( ) : void
Результат void

GetFileType() публичный статический Метод

public static GetFileType ( DICOMObject d ) : DICOMFileType
d DICOMObject
Результат DICOMFileType

StudyIdAnonymizer() публичный Метод

public StudyIdAnonymizer ( ) : EvilDICOM.Core
Результат EvilDICOM.Core